Jane and Mara met with their friends at their favorite hang out place. They ordered some beer and some food.

"You've been acting strange since you arrived, what's up?" Lory asked Jane trying to break the ice.

"I guess I'm just tired juggling studies and basketball", Jane responded, but at the back of her mind, her mysterious hero hasn't left her mind, and that's what's been bothering her.

"And lovelife..." Mara added. Everyone laughed. "Did that Julia stress you out?" Mara teased.

Jane might have gone to so many dates in the past, but she's never had a real and serious relationship. As naive as it sounds, she has never felt what it was to fall seriously in love. She has had petty crushes, happy crushes, but has yet to find someone who can sweep her off her feet. She's not looking for one though, and she's not wondering just yet, but what if this could be for her?

Their hangout was a gasoline station that's like a tiny mall. It has a 24/7 convenience store, that has outdoor kiosks and gazebos for people to hangout. Inside the glass-cased store is a deli and a cafe with a pizza stall attached to it, and a mini-mart.

By day, it was a simple convenience store, but at weekend night, it turns into an outdoor party place where upgraded sports cars lineup and blast their radios, or sometimes, the store hires a DJ to play some party music, and people just party the night away.

This night was a meet up for upgraded cars. Mara's boyfriend, Paolo, is an enthusiast and is a member of GroundImage, a group of modified car enthusiasts. Some cars were already there with hoods open and some blasting party music upgraded by subwoofers. Jane and her friends were at one of the kiosks waiting for Paolo to arrive with his newly modified Honda City.

A few minutes later, Paolo arrived with his white 2012 Honda City with blue under glow and cool black spoilers. As soon as he was parked, he opened his hood exposing blue and purple interior beaming with LED lights. People started gathering and pacing back and forth looking and scanning the different cars lining up.

A while after, a midnight black-purple 1999 limited edition Mitsubishi Galant arrived and parked near the store entrance. It was not a modified one, nor a member of the group, but its simple look had sophistication in it and it had a cool sound coming out from its exhaust.

A girl and a guy went out of the car. The guy approached the exhibition of cars while the girl walked inside the store. The driver, a lady one, followed inside the store.

They look familiar. Jane was studying the girls from afar but was cut off.

Paolo was introducing the new guy to the group. "Hey guys, this is Ali. His our new guy. He just arrived from the US, but he is also an enthusiast back there in the US."

Ali shook everyone's hands, they had a conversation, talking about cars, accessories, etc.

Mara grabbed Jane asking her to accompany her to the store. "I'm thirsty," Mara said, "let's grab some water or soda".

Jane agreed without hesitation. It was her chance to see who those girls were in the store. As soon as Jane pulled the glass door open, she came face to face with her mysterious girl.

This time, their eyes met with nothing but air between them. Her wavy hair hanging lightly as the outside wind briefly blew on her face. Jane could see the girl's face clearer this time. The lights from the store seemed to form a spotlight, focusing only at the girl in front of her.

Jane felt a lump in her throat. She wanted to utter a word, even just a hi, but she's tongue-tied and dumbfounded by the beauty in front of her.

God, she's so beautiful.

"Excuse me, can you let me through?" the girl said.

"Oh... I—I'm sorry" Jane soon realized she'd been standing there for some seconds. She gave way as the girl walked towards the car.

Jane is the worst at first encounters, and she just let her mysterious girl pass by, with it, the opportunity to know her.

"I sense something here," Mara began.

"What?"

"I know what I saw there. I know you from head to toe Jane. Why don't you go talk to her?"

"You know I'm so bad at first encounters. I can't."

Mara just let out a chuckle, grabbing a bottle of water at the huge fridge. Jane opened the same and grabbed a soda. They could hear the glass door opening, as someone entered the store again.

"I think you have a crush," Mara teased. Jane did not respond but merely signaled for Mara to lower her voice, as they walked to the cashier to pay.

"Order for Janella!" the cashier called out.

A girl approached the counter and now, standing beside Jane was her mysterious girl. Janella. She felt weak being aware of this gorgeous girl's presence beside her.

The barrista placed Janella's order at the counter while the cashier handed Jane's change. Jane's heart was banging wildly in her chest that she absentmindedly grabbed Janella's order at the counter, and now she's holding Janella's hand, who's also holding on to her cup.

"Janella", Janella said pointing to the cup.

"Jane!" Jane blurted out.

"No, I meant that's my name on the cup," Janella replied, a smile forming on her mouth.

Oh crap! "So—sorry I didn't mean to. I have mine." Jane explained pointing to her soda. The store's air conditioner was blasted full but she could feel sweat trickling down her forehead.

Janella walked away, while Jane stood there still shocked and embarrassed. Jane did a facepalm realizing what just transpired.

"I can't believe what you just did," Mara teased pointing at Jane's reddened face, laughing her heart out.

"Shut the fuck up, Mara!" Jane responded laughing at her own stupidity. "This is why I hate first encounters."

Mara has been laughing continuously. Moments after, she calmed herself down and suddenly shifted to a serious tone, "But seriously, I've never seen you this way before."

Jane just gave her best friend a blank look.

Mara and Jane was now back with the group, and Jane still can't get over what just happened. Upon reaching the group, Jane was taken aback as she saw Janella and the other girl with Ali. Ali has his arm on Janella's shoulder, as they were talking and laughing.

At the sight of it, Jane resigned, and Mara gave her a nudge, "Uh-oh!"

"This is my girlfriend, Mara." Paolo grabbed Mara, "and her best friend, Jane. This is Janella and Liza. They're sisters, and Ali is their cousin". That felt like a relief to Jane.

"Oh it's you," Janella uttered gazing her eyes on Jane.

"So, you met?" Paolo asked looking surprised, while Jane could feel her face growing red.

"Kind of.. in some not-so-comfortable chances," Janella replied with a sly smile. She's gracelessly charming, Janella thought, her gaze not leaving Jane's.

The night was still young so each of them took a seat. Paolo and Mara were seated at Jane's left while Janella was luckily seated at Jane's right. Mara was busy with Paolo. Ali and Liza were talking. While Jane sat quietly next to Janella.

Gathering all her courage, she managed to start a conversation. Jane's bad at first encounters so this would be her first time to make the first move to start a conversation.

"Hi. I'm Jane de Leon, we're freshmen Human Biology."

Mara couldn't help but eavesdrop on Jane and raised a brow. She's trying to contain her laughter but she doesn't want to interrupt. So, she grabbed her phone and texted, "WTF, Jane? What kind of an introduction is that?"

Janella could see Jane's notification, as the latter grabbed her phone to read the message. Janella let out a shy laugh.

"I know, Jane."

"Sorry I'm so bad at first encounters. But I feel relieved seeing you smile this time. The few times we crossed each other's paths, you barely smile. I almost thought you hated seeing me."

"And the few times we crossed each other's paths, you look so clumsy. I almost thought you were dumb."

"Well, that's not fair," and they both laughed.

"You have pretty nice car there. That's a 1999 Mitsubishi Galant, right? A limited edition." Jane finally began.

"Yes. It's a gift from our dad. Did you know that the Mercedes Benz almost filed a suit against Mitsubishi over that design?"

"Really?"

"Yes, if you look at it. It looks like one of Benz's car."

"I didn't know that. I'll look that up. I'm not really into cars but I like your car's design. It's sleek and sophisticated."

"You drive a Corolla, right? I still remember the night you waited for us."

"Yes, it's a 2012 model. I stole it from my dad," Jane joked, and they both laughed.

"Thanks for that night, by the way."

"Anytime," and for that, Jane raised her glass of beer to toast with Janella.

And so began their conversation. Jane learned that Janella was also studying Biology in the same school. She's a sophomore, just a year ahead but she's of the same age. At a young age, she was accelerated and advanced in school.

Jane also learned that Janella and Julia are friends, not the closest ones but they hangout together in school. She also learned that Janella's sister, Liza, already dumped Julien. Good for her! She even thought.

They did not want to drink too much because most of them still have to drive, so they soon bid goodbyes to everyone.

"It was nice meeting you, Jane," Janella whispered with a wink as they stood from where they were seated. Jane could feel her knees go weak. Janella seemed to have taken a hold of her, and she did not know what to do. Her mysterious girl's name was no longer a mystery, yet there was still a mystery about her. There was something enchanting about Janella, it's difficult to resist.

"See you around, I hope," Janella continued, as the trio walked to her car. Jane's gaze followed them. Mara gave Jane a little nudge with her elbow, "Really smooth there." Mara was happy her friend had finally had the courage to start a conversation.

What Jane couldn't see was Janella's smile etched on her face, as the latter and her companions walked towards her car.

Janella could still remember how the eyes inside the car met hers while she was straightening up her shirt. Those eyes met hers without realizing that she could actually see her from the inside, but she pretended not to notice because she did not want to scare those eyes away. She was glued to them, they were such a pretty sight.

She was so upset about that night, after hearing from her sister how she was cheated by her girlfriend. She came all the way from their house to her sister's cheer dance practice because she heard her cry over the phone, and being a protective sister, she drove all the way to school for her.

After hearing someone interrupt her and her sister's conversation, she was about to get upset, but when she turned to look, her eyes were met by the other girl's doe eyes. Those eyes melted her, and hearing her voice comforted her.

"But if you don't mind, I'll keep you company for a while until you get inside. Just pretend I'm not here. I'll be by the car. And you won't even notice that I'm here. I'll leave as soon as you get inside."

The truth is Janella appreciated that small gesture, that someone wanted to look after them that night. After her encounter with her sister's butch girlfriend, she wished to get to know even the name of that caring girl, but she sped away.

Many times she tried to approach her but what stops her is the way girls flock to her to appreciate her and sometimes, even flirt with her. She did not want to be just another girl, so she kept her distance.

What added to her predicament is her friend, Julia, who was so vocal about her crush. So Janella decided to keep it to herself.

Jane, Jane de Leon... Janella just can't stop smiling.

"Ate, aren't you going to start the engine yet?"

"Oh right..." so Janella turned on the ignition.

"She's cute, isn't she," Ali said teasing Janella. "I think the feeling is mutual".

Janella looked at Ali through the rear view mirror and raised a brow. She didn't say a word this time, all she knew was she was content to get to know her mysterious girl this time. Whatever lies ahead, she doesn't know but she's happy to get to know her.
